Verizon Global Infrastructure is seeking an experienced Lab and Standards Automation Architect to lead the design, development, and testing of our enterprise-wide network automation and configuration management framework. This role will play a crucial part in driving network transformation by integrating automation design, development support, and standard modernization into a unified, cloud-native framework.

You will be responsible for the overall Configuration Management architecture and strategy, with a primary focus on establishing and maintaining the Golden Config across the global estate. You will be working with cutting-edge technology, driving vendor roadmaps, and redefining the future of network reliability through AI-driven automation.

What you'll be doing...

Strategic Vision & Roadmap

  • Defining the strategic vision and translate complex business requirements into a comprehensive network architecture roadmap.

  • Ensuring the roadmap supports seamless automation, cloud integration, and emerging technologies.

  • Leading the design and implementation of Configuration Management strategies, encompassing both automation and enterprise-wide compliance auditing.

Automation-Friendly Design

  • Creating architectural patterns and designs that are inherently automation-friendly, prioritizing the use of APIs and software-defined networking.

  • Defining technical standards and roadmaps for automation deployment to ensure scalability across lab and production environments.

  • Building Low Level Design (LLD) diagrams to communicate automation workflows and design goals to implementation teams.

Development & Lab Support

  • Supporting development teams by providing access to a secure Lab environment featuring both virtual (e.g., CML) and physical devices.

  • Serving as a Subject Matter Expert (SME) to guide engineering teams on modern software development practices within network operations.

  • Leading proof-of-concepts (PoCs) and pilot projects to validate new AI frameworks and automation capabilities.

Standards Modernization

  • Modernizing the standards process and configuration templates to ensure they are easily consumed by both human developers and AI tools.

  • Collaborating with security and networking teams to integrate automated security policies and modernize technical standards.

  • Driving the adoption of "Network as Code" and automated testing to accelerate feature development.

Partnership & Evaluation

  • Evaluating and recommending automation vendors and tools (e.g., HPNA, Cisco NSO) to ensure they meet enterprise requirements.

  • Partnering with IT leadership to leverage AI and Copilot frameworks to enhance configuration management.

  • Building strong vendor relationships to influence roadmaps for AI-driven automation tools.
